Editorial scope and policies
Journal of Managed Care Pharmacy (JMCP) is dedicated to providing managed care pharmacists with the current information they need to excel in their daily practices.
As the official journal of the Academy of Managed Care Pharmacy, JMCP is a cornerstone of membership services for one of the fastest-growing associations in pharmacy. The journal is peer reviewed, and only articles meeting high scholarly standards indicative of sound, reproducible, and valid research are accepted.
Editorial content is determined by the Editor-in-Chief with suggestions from the Editorial Advisory Board. The views and opinions expressed in JMCP do not necessarily reflect or represent official policy of the Academy or the authors' institutions unless specifically stated.
Editorial Content
Journal of Managed Care Pharmacy contains three basic types of editorial material: peer-reviewed scholarly articles, news-oriented feature articles, and departments. Articles should be organized, written, and formatted for a specific part or section of the journal. Instructions for Authors are published in each issue of JMCP.
Peer-Reviewed Articles
The heart of the journal is its peer-reviewed scholarly research, review, and report articles in five sections:
Comparative Research: articles using the scientific method to compare definitively two or more alternative hypotheses.
Review Articles: papers that review recent clinical, economic, or management literature and offer synthesized summaries relevant to the managed care pharmacy field.
Descriptive Reports: articles describing experiences or solutions to practical problems within managed care pharmacy settings.
Reprise: articles reprinted from other journals of special importance to managed care or managed care pharmacy.
Continuing Education: invited reviews of timely topics with continuing education credit (generally published in each issue).
Feature Articles
Feature articles highlight news and information of current interest to managed care pharmacists, pharmacy personnel, and other health care providers. Topics are selected based on advice from JMCP's Editorial Advisory Board of managed care pharmacists and administrators, educators, and industry representatives.
The Spotlight section in each issue focuses on a single topic of importance in managed care.

Departments
Departments provide member-contributed and staff-written information of practical and immediate value to journal readers:
Feedback: JMCP's letters to the editor.
Perspectives: editorials by outside contributors as well as the editors.
CE Exam: continuing education material for Continuing Education articles.
Campus: updates from the pharmacy education world about inclusion of managed care topics in college curricula, activities of faculty and students interested in managed care, and techniques for teaching managed care principles to pharmacy students.
Trends: news articles about current events in managed care pharmacy.
Pipeline: coverage of newly approved drugs and those in development.
Caveats: updates from the legal and regulatory world.
International: articles describing managed care and/or pharmacy developments and emerging markets in foreign countries.
Media: updates, critiques, and information on books, software, multimedia, and other forms of current literature.
Events: calendar for managed care pharmacists.
AMCProgress: news and information about the Academy and the activities of its leaders, members, and staff on behalf of managed care pharmacy
Advertising Policy
A copy of the full advertising policy for JMCP is available from AMCP headquarters and the Advertising Representative listed on the masthead. All aspects of the advertising sales and solicitation process are completely independent of the editorial process. Advertising is interspersed throughout the editorial material other than peer-reviewed articles. Advertising is not accepted for placement opposite or near related editorial copy.
Employees of advertisers may submit articles for publication in the editorial sections of JMCP, subject to the usual peer-review process. Financial disclosure and conflict of interest statements are required when manuscripts are submitted, and these may be published at the discretion of the Editor-in-Chief if the article is printed.
